6 Top Solo Travel Destinations with Affordable Accommodations:
1. Southeast Asia

Countries: Thailand, Vietnam, Cambodia, Indonesia
Highlights: Stunning beaches, temples, street food, adventure sports
Accommodations: Hostels ($5–$15/night), guesthouses, budget hotels
Activities: Island hopping, trekking, cooking classes, cultural tours
Solo Travel Perks: Strong backpacker community and safe areas for independent exploration
2. Eastern Europe
Countries: Poland, Hungary, Czech Republic, Romania
Highlights: Historic cities, castles, scenic landscapes
Accommodations: Hostels ($10–$20/night), Airbnb, budget hotels
Activities: Free walking tours, river cruises, hiking trails
Solo Travel Perks: Walkable cities, friendly locals, low cost of living
3. Latin America
Countries: Mexico, Colombia, Peru, Ecuador
Highlights: Vibrant culture, markets, beaches, mountains
Accommodations: Hostels ($8–$25/night), guesthouses
Activities: Machu Picchu trek, salsa classes, city tours
Solo Travel Perks: Strong traveler networks, community-oriented hostels
4. India
Highlights: Taj Mahal, Jaipur forts, Kerala backwaters, Himalayan treks
Accommodations: Budget hotels ($10–$25/night), hostels, homestays
Activities: Yoga retreats, temple visits, street food exploration
Solo Travel Perks: Safe travel hubs for independent travelers and affordable costs
5. Portugal

Highlights: Lisbon’s old streets, Porto’s riverfront, Algarve beaches
Accommodations: Hostels ($15–$25/night), budget hotels, guesthouses
Activities: Walking tours, surfing, local wine tastings
Solo Travel Perks: Walkable cities, English-speaking locals, vibrant café culture
Types of Affordable Accommodations for Solo Travelers:
1. Hostels
Ideal for solo travelers seeking social interactions
Dorm-style or private rooms, often with communal kitchens and lounges
Platforms: Hostelworld, Booking.com
2. Guesthouses
Local-style homes converted into budget-friendly stays
Often include breakfast and cultural immersion opportunities
3. Budget Hotels
Basic amenities, clean rooms, and convenient locations
Usually more privacy than hostels, still affordable
4. Vacation Rentals
Airbnb or similar platforms allow renting rooms or apartments
Great for longer stays or privacy-conscious travelers
5. Couchsurfing
Social platform connecting travelers with locals
Offers free stays and opportunities to learn about local culture
6 Solo Travel Tips for Budget-Friendly Trips:
1. Plan Ahead
Research destinations, transportation options, and budget accommodations
Book hostels and hotels in advance for peak seasons
2. Travel Off-Peak
Avoid high-season rates to save on flights and lodging
Experience attractions with fewer crowds
3. Use Public Transportation
Local buses, trains, and metro systems are cost-effective and efficient
Renting bikes or walking also reduces expenses
4. Join Social Activities
Hostels, walking tours, and cultural workshops help meet fellow travelers
Ideal for solo explorers seeking connections
5. Stay Safe
Choose neighborhoods with good lighting and traveler-friendly reviews
Keep valuables secure and stay aware of surroundings
6. Eat Like a Local
Street food and local markets are cheaper than tourist restaurants
Provides authentic culinary experiences

Sample Solo Travel Itinerary:
7 Days in Thailand (Budget-Friendly Solo Trip)
Day 1: Bangkok – Explore temples and street markets
Day 2: Bangkok – Khao San Road, hostel social events
Day 3: Ayutthaya – Day trip from Bangkok
Day 4: Chiang Mai – Visit night markets, rent a motorbike
Day 5: Chiang Mai – Elephant sanctuary day trip
Day 6: Pai – Trekking, hot springs, and local cafés
Day 7: Return to Bangkok – Departure
Estimated Daily Budget: $20–$40 USD, including accommodation, meals, and local transportation
